A well presented three bedroom semi-detached home, offering spacious and thoughtfully arranged accommodation, ideal for families, set within a popular village location.

The property is entered via an entrance hall with a useful ground floor WC. To the front, the home opens into a large open plan kitchen and dining room, providing an excellent space for everyday living and entertaining, with a central island and ample storage. To the rear, there is an impressive living room spanning the width of the property, filled with natural light and enjoying views over the garden. A separate utility room adds further practicality.

On the first floor there are three bedrooms, including a generous principal bedroom, along with a dressing area and a modern shower room serving the accommodation.

Externally, the property benefits from driveway parking to the front providing off road parking. The rear garden is a particular feature of the home, being long, mature and well maintained, offering a private and attractive outdoor space ideal for relaxing and entertaining.

Harlton is a well regarded village located to the south-west of Cambridge, offering a peaceful rural setting while remaining within easy reach of the city. The area benefits from nearby amenities in surrounding villages and good access to commuter routes including the M11 and A603. Schooling in the area is well regarded, with several nearby options rated Good by Ofsted, making it well suited for families.
